Because OLPC XO will be sold to general public with G1G1:

1. The user may be adult big fingers. Is it possible to use standard size, external USB keyboard and mouse with XO laptops?

2. The user may want to use other Linux Distro using LiveCD, such as Knoppix, DSL, etc. Unfortunately Linux on XO must use modified/patched kernel and different boot method. Is there any wiki / HOWTO on creating Linux LiveCD for booting XO laptops from external USB CD-ROM drive or external flash drive?

http://www.livecdlist.com

3. In Vietnam and India, the government plan to use WiMax, not WiFi in rural areas. In developing countries such as Singapore, Korea, Taiwan, Japan, USA, there are new project to deploy WiMax network. Is it possible to use external WiMax with OLPC?
The public user in developing countries may want to use WiMax, not WiFi. Can the governments in developing countries order OLPC XO with built-in WiMax, not WiFi?

4. According to Insyde, the BIOS for OLPC XO laptops should be provided by vendor (OLPC) and customer cannot buy the BIOS directly from Insyde. Can OLPC sell the Insyde BIOS as optional add-on for public (through G1G1)?
